#860a1d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#860a1d is composed of 52.5% red, 3.9%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.5% magenta, 78.4%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 350.8 degrees, a saturation of 86.1% and a lightness of 28.2%. #860a1d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ff143a with #0d0000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

Shades and Tints of #860a1d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060001 is the darkest color, while #fef3f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#860a1d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494747 is the less saturated color, while #8c0419 is the most saturated one.
